The BedChoose a bed with built-in storage drawers underneath, sometimes referred to as a storage bed. The pull-out drawers can be used to store clothes, if there is no room for a dresser due to limited space, or seasonal blankets or toys. Beds that include storage space in the headboard can provide additional storage for books or decorative items. Also, a twin size bed for a child will allow for more storage opportunities in other areas of the room.The WallsAnchor a bookshelf or cube storage center to the wall to increase storage space for toys or books. Hang wooden shelves on the walls to hold breakable or keepsake items that are not for everyday use or play. Place a wooden toy chest in a corner to house dress up costumes.The ClosetUse the closet as an extra storage space by placing wire rack shelving or a 3-shelf bookcase on the closet floor.
